The Clinical Trials Landscape for Alzheimer's Disease

Clinical trials for Alzheimer's disease (AD) show a broad landscape of drug, non-drug, and non-therapeutic research. Emerging trends in prevention and microbiome research offer future therapeutic and diagnostic avenues.

Background:
- The scope of Alzheimer's disease (AD) clinical trials, encompassing drug, non-drug, and non-therapeutic research, remains incompletely understood.
- Characterizing the landscape of AD research is crucial for identifying trends and future directions.
Purpose of the Study:
- To comprehensively analyze the trends and focus areas of clinical studies in Alzheimer's disease over the past two decades.
- To map the evolution of drug development, non-drug interventions, and non-therapeutic research in AD.
Main Methods:
- Analysis of 1681 AD clinical trials registered in clinicaltrials.gov.
- Bibliometric network analysis of 565 associated publications in PubMed.
- Categorization of research objectives and interventions, including drug classes, non-drug therapies, and non-therapeutic research areas.
Main Results:
- Frequent keywords in publications include "safety," "dose," "adverse events," and "biomarker."
- Top drug classes target amyloid, acetylcholine, or neurotransmitter receptors.
- Leading non-drug therapies are physical therapy, diet, and cognitive training; non-therapeutic research focuses on imaging, risk factors, and biomarkers.
- Significant upward trends were observed in prevention, risk factors, and microbiome research (Ptrend < 0.05).
Conclusions:
- Recent successes like lecanemab and decanemab validate ongoing efforts in AD drug development and pathogenesis research.
- The increasing focus on non-drug interventions and non-therapeutic research, particularly in prevention and microbiome studies, suggests promising future avenues for AD management and treatment.
